Andrew Sullivan gets it done and provides the You Tube of Obama's Iowa victory speech (below).

Excellent stuff -- it turned out Obama (38%), Edwards (30%), Clinton (29%). Andrew sticks his neck out a little bit with this quote, but I'm in if he is:

"Simply put: he sounded like a president. The theme was not just change; it was a new unity. And as a black man, he helps heal the past as well as forge the future. This really was history tonight. To win so many white voices, and bring together so many minorities, and use the unifying language that leaves the toxins of race and partisanship behind: This was the moment America stopped being afraid.
This was the America we have missed and have found again."
